Composites derived from metal-organic frameworks(MOFs)show promise as catalysts for the photocat-alytic reduction of CO_(2).However,their potential is hindered by constraints such as limited light absorp-tion and sluggish electron transfer and separation,impacting the overall efficiency of the photocatalytic process.In this study,TiO_(2)nanocrystals,modified with Ptx+,underwent laser etching were encapsulated within the traditional MOF-ZIF-8 framework.This enhanced the adsorption capabilities for CO_(2)reactants and solar light,while also facilitating directed electron transfer and the separation of photogenerated charges.The finely-tuned catalyst demonstrates impressive CH_(4) selectivity at 9.5%,with yields of 250.24μmol g^(-1)h^(-1)for CO and 25.43μmol g^(-1)h^(-1)for CH_(4),utilizing water as a hole trap and H^(+)source.This study demonstrates the viability of achieving characteristics related to the separation of photogen-erated charges in TiO_(2)nanocrystals through laser etching and MOF composite catalysts.It offers novel perspectives for designing MOF-based catalysts with enhanced performance in artificial photosynthesis. 展开更多

A web service wrapping approach for command line programs,which are commonly used in scientific computing,is proposed.First,software architecture for a basic web service wrapper implementation is given and the functions of the main components are explained.Then after a comprehensive analysis of data transmission and a job life cycle model,a novel proactive file transmission and job management mechanism is devised to enhance the software architecture,and the command line programs are wrapped into web services in such a way that they can efficiently transmit files,supply instant status feedback and automatically manage the jobs.Experiments show that the proposed approach achieves higher performance with less memory usage compared to the related work, and the usability is also improved.This work has already been put into use in a production system of scientific computing and the data processing efficiency of the system is greatly improved. 展开更多

In specific condition, when wrapping angle of cold rolling strip covering surface of shape detecting roll dynamically changes, online radial compression of the shape detecting roll is changed too, and it seriously affects online shape detecting precision of cold strip. Based on the latest intelligent shape meter developed by Yanshan University, using PSO-BP neural network and actual working condition datum, the cold strip online dynamic wrapping angle compensation model is established, and successfully applied in 1250 mm 6-high cold mill, remarkable results are achieved. The error between calculated values and measured values of total tensions is within 3 % 展开更多

Objective: After pancreaticoduodenectomy (PD), the postoperative gastroduodenal artery stump (GDAS) hemorrhage is one of the most serious complications. The purpose of this study is to determine whether wrapping the GDAS during PD could decrease the postoperative GDAS hemorrhage incidence. Methods: A retrospective review involving 280 patients who underwent PD from 2005 to 2012 was performed. Wrapping the GDAS during PD was defined as "Wrapping the GDAS using the teres hepatis ligamentum during PD". A total of 140 patients accepted the "wrapping" procedure (wrapping group). The other 140 patients didn't apply the procedure (non-wrapping group). Age, sex, preoperative data, estimated intraoperative blood loss, postoperative complications, pathologic parameters and hospitalization time were compared between two groups. ResultsI There were no significant differences in patient characteristics between two groups. After wrapping, the incidence of postoperative GDAS bleeding decreased significantly (1/140 vs. 9/140, P=0.01). The rates of the other complications (such as intra-abdominal infection pancreatic fistula, billiary fistula, gastrointestinal bleeding, et aL) showed no significant differences. Conclusions: Wrapping the GDAS during PD significantly reduced the postoperative GDAS hemorrhage incidence. And the "wrapping" had no obvious influence on other complications. 展开更多

AIM: To retrospectively compare postoperative outcomes after primary enucleation and placement of a hydroxyapatite(HA) implant without wrapping, wrapped with auricular cartilage or donor sclera. METHODS: Medical records of patients presented as intraocular tumor or severe ocular injury were identified from the electronic medical record system. Cases underwent enucleation and HA orbital implantation were enrolled in this study and were divided into 3 groups according to the wrapping material of HA implant. Cases with autogenous cartilage caps were enrolled in group A(n=11), with donor sclera caps in group B(n=12), and without any wrapping material in group C(n=9). Follow-ups were set at 1, 2 wk, 1, 3, 6, and 12 mo after surgery.RESULTS: Altogether 32 cases finished the followup and were enrolled in this study. Three cases(27.27%) in group A, 4 cases(33.33%) in group B, and 4 cases(44.44%) in group C developed one complication each after surgery. In group A, no HA exposure occurred, but conjunctival inclusion cyst occurred in one and severe conjunctive chemosis in two cases. In group B, one HA exposure occurred, conjunctive inclusion cysts occurred in one, severe conjunctive chemosis occurred in one, and conjunctival granuloma occurred in one case. In group C, one HA exposure occurred, severe conjunctive chemosis occurred in two cases, and conjunctival granuloma occurred in one case. The case of exposure of none-wrapped implant was noted in the first 6 mo after placement of the orbital implant. The case of exposure of donor sclerawrapped implant was noted at the 12 mo after placement of the orbital implant. Both exposure cases were treated successfully with conservative treatment.CONCLUSION: With low incidence of implant exposure and mild complications, auricular cartilage can be a good choice of alternative wrapping material of orbit implant with satisfied outcome. 展开更多

A novel multi-baseline phase unwrapping algorithm based on the unscented particle filter for interferometric synthetic aperture radar (INSAR) technology application is proposed. The proposed method is not constrained by the nonlinearity of the problem and is independent of noise statistics, and performs noise eliminating and phase unwrapping at the same time by combining with an unscented particle filter with a path-following strategy and an omni-directional local phase slope estimator. Results obtained from multi-baseline synthetic data and single-baseline real data show the performance of the proposed method. 展开更多

Currently,data security mainly relies on password(PW)or system channel key(SKCH)to encrypt data before they are sent,no matter whether in broadband networks,the 5th generation(5G)mobile communications,satellite communications,and so on.In these environments,a fixed password or channel key(e.g.,PW/SKCH)is often adopted to encrypt different data,resulting in security risks since thisPW/SKCH may be solved after hackers collect a huge amount of encrypted data.Actually,the most popularly used security mechanism Advanced Encryption Standard(AES)has its own problems,e.g.,several rounds have been solved.On the other hand,if data protected by the same PW/SKCH at different time points can derive different data encryption parameters,the system’s security level will be then greatly enhanced.Therefore,in this study,a security scheme,named Wrapping Encryption Based on Double Randomness Mechanism(WEBDR),is proposed by integrating a password key(or a system channel key)and an Initialization Vector(IV)to generate an Initial Encryption Key(IEK).Also,an Accumulated Shifting Substitution(ASS)function and a three-dimensional encryption method are adopted to produce a set of keys.Two randomness encryption mechanisms are developed.The first generates system sub-keys and calculates the length of the first pseudo-random numbers by employing IEK for providing subsequent encryption/decryption.The second produces a random encryption key and a sequence of internal feedback codes and computes the length of the second pseudo-random numbers for encrypting delivered messages.A wrapped mechanism is further utilized to pack a ciphertext file so that a wrapped ciphertext file,rather than the ciphertext,will be produced and then transmitted to its destination.The findings are as follows.Our theoretic analyses and simulations demonstrate that the security of the WEBDR in cloud communication has achieved its practical security.Also,AES requires 176 times exclusive OR(XOR)operations for both encryption and decryption,while the WEBDR consumes only 3 operations.That is why the WEBDR is 6.7∼7.09 times faster than the AES,thus more suitable for replacing the AES to protect data transmitted between a cloud system and its users. 展开更多

Specific to problems of the existing round bale wrapping machine in China,such as small application scope and failing to satisfy the wrapping demands of round bales of different specifications,a tumbler-type round bale wrapping machine based on wrapping silage with stretch film was designed.By theoretical analysis and preliminary experiments of the corresponding wrapping process,revolving speed of tumbler,speed ratio between tumbler and carrier rollers,and pre-load force of stretch film were determined as experimental factors,while wrapping time and consumption of stretch film per unit mass of round bale were determined as evaluation indexes.Furthermore,quadratic regression orthogonal rotational combination experimental design was adopted to carry out the wrapping experiment.The regression models were set up,and influencing rules of experimental factors on evaluation indexes were also analyzed.The optimal parameter combination scheme was revolving speed of tumbler of 31-32 r/min,speed ratio between tumbler and carrier rollers of 2.6,and pre-load force of stretch film of 20-22 N.Under such a circumstance,the corresponding wrapping time required was 37.7-38.9 s and consumption of stretch film per unit mass of round bale was 3.21-3.46 kg/t.The predicted values and the measured values of evaluation indexes basically coincided with each other and the relative error fell below 5%,which indicated that both the optimized regression models acquired through the wrapping experiment and the relevant parameter optimization results were reliable.To guarantee the quality of rice straw silage,the round bale should be wrapped by no less than five layers of stretch films through the utilization of the tumbler-type round bale wrapping machine.The study results could be used as references for research and development of the round bale wrapping machine. 展开更多

目的探究乙型肝炎病毒(HBV)相关肝细胞癌患者血清尿路上皮癌相关1(UCA1)和含TP53反义的WD重复序列(WRAP53)水平与肝癌的关系。方法选取2022年6月至2024年3月于乐至县人民医院肿瘤内科接受治疗的HBV相关肝细胞癌患者82例作为观察组,选择... 目的探究乙型肝炎病毒(HBV)相关肝细胞癌患者血清尿路上皮癌相关1(UCA1)和含TP53反义的WD重复序列(WRAP53)水平与肝癌的关系。方法选取2022年6月至2024年3月于乐至县人民医院肿瘤内科接受治疗的HBV相关肝细胞癌患者82例作为观察组,选择同期慢性HBV感染者80例作为对照组。实时荧光定量PCR测定患者血清UCA1和WRAP53水平,应用二元logistic回归模型分析慢性HBV感染者肝癌发生的危险因素。采用受试者工作特征(ROC)曲线及曲线下面积(AUC)评估UCA1和WRAP53对HBV相关肝细胞癌的诊断效能。结果观察组血清UCA1和WRAP53的表达水平分别为(2.42±0.72)和(3.16±1.07),高于对照组的(1.25±0.37)和(1.18±0.31),差异有统计学意义(t=13.054、16.079,均P<0.05)。Logistic回归分析表明,UCA1和WRAP53水平升高是慢性HBV感染者肝癌发生的独立危险因素。ROC曲线分析显示,UCA1和WRAP53诊断慢性HBV感染者肝癌发生的灵敏度分别为84.1%和90.2%;特异度分别为88.7%和96.3%;AUC分别为0.921和0.930,显示了两者在诊断慢性HBV感染者肝癌发生的高准确性。而当UCA1和WRAP53联合预测时,灵敏度和特异度分别为93.9%和98.8%,AUC值则达到0.980,表明联合检测具有更高的预测效能。结论HBV相关肝细胞癌患者的血清UCA1和WRAP53水平显著升高,这些标志物可作为HBV相关肝细胞癌的潜在诊断工具,具有较高的诊断价值。 展开更多

Axonal regeneration following surgical nerve repair is slow and often incomplete,resulting in poor functional recovery which sometimes contributes to lifelong disability.Currently,there are no FDA-approved therapies available to promote nerve regeneration.Tacrolimus accelerates axonal regeneration,but systemic side effects presently outweigh its potential benefits for peripheral nerve surgery.The authors describe herein a biodegradable polyurethane-based drug delivery system for the sustained local release of tacrolimus at the nerve repair site,with suitable properties for scalable production and clinical application,aiming to promote nerve regeneration and functional recovery with minimal systemic drug exposure.Tacrolimus is encapsulated into co-axially electrospun polycarbonate-urethane nanofibers to generate an implantable nerve wrap that releases therapeutic doses of bioactive tacrolimus over 31 days.Size and drug loading are adjustable for applications in small and large caliber nerves,and the wrap degrades within 120 days into biocompatible byproducts.Tacrolimus released from the nerve wrap promotes axon elongation in vitro and accelerates nerve regeneration and functional recovery in preclinical nerve repair models while off-target systemic drug exposure is reduced by 80%compared with systemic delivery.Given its surgical suitability and preclinical efficacy and safety,this system may provide a readily translatable approach to support axonal regeneration and recovery in patients undergoing nerve surgery. 展开更多

Cu with and without La addition was prepared and the effect of a trace amount of La on the arc erosion behaviors and oxidation resistance of Cu alloys was investigated. The results indicate that CuLa alloy exhibits superior oxidation resistance and arc erosion resistance. The contact resistance and temperature rise were obviously improved. The oxidation resistance of CuLa alloy mainly is due to the interface wrapping of La2O3 particles and CuLa alloy phase on Cu atoms. Thermodynamic calculation indicated that La2O3 could form preferentially in the CuLa alloy, which was beneficial for the protection of the Cu substrate. According to kinetics analysis, the activation energy of CuLa alloy was higher than that of pure Cu, indicating the better oxidation resistance of CuLa alloys. 展开更多

Curvelet变换表示曲线奇异函数的异向性及图像边缘时,具有比小波变换更优的表示特性。针对小波图像降噪存在的不足,分析基于wrapping算法的快速离散曲波变换的特点,提出结合循环平移、厄尔迭代方法和蒙特卡洛阈值规则的新消噪方法。该算法充分利用曲波系数的相关性,消除了因Curvelet变换缺乏平移不变性引起的图像"划痕"失真和"振铃"效应。实验结果表明,该算法与传统的小波消噪、二代小波消噪、小波包消噪和曲波硬阈值消噪相比,得到降噪图像的峰值信噪比更高,视觉效果更好。 展开更多

Graphene-metal based materials have been utilized in lithium-sulfur(Li–S)batteries owing to their integrated functionalities thus far.However,their synthesis has predominantly relied on wet-chemistry routes,which limited their practical activity in Li–S reaction systems.In this study,we introduce a chemical vapor deposition(CVD)-triggered dry-chemistry approach for the preparation of graphene-cobalt(Co)based catalysts.The versatile CVD technique provides a dry and controllable reaction environment,effectively pledging the compact and clean catalytic interfaces between graphene and Co-based components.Additionally,programmed reactions introduce defects such as vacancies and nitrogen heteroatoms into the catalysts.Notably,the graphene layer number and Co valence state can be delicately manipulated by altering the CVD reaction temperature.Specifically,few-layer graphene wrapped Co/Co_(3)O_(4)(FGr-Co/Co_(3)O_(4))prepared at 450 ℃ shows higher catalytic activity than the multi-layer graphene wrapped Co/CoO(MGr-Co/CoO)synthesized at 550 ℃,attributed to its comprehensive control of clean interface,valence distribution range and defects.Leveraging these advantages,the battery with FGr-Co/Co_(3)O_(4)shows favorable working stability with a degradation rate of only 0.08%over 500 cycles at 1.0 C.Furthermore,under an elevated sulfur loading of 6.1 mg cm^(–2),the battery harvests a remarkable areal capacity of 5.9 mA h cm^(–2)along with stable cyclic operation. 展开更多
